In addition to cross-dressing, characters also say and do things that suggest they are unclear about one's gender.

Coach Z

  • Email 2 emails — Coach Z picks up a name tag and claims he's "Hot Girl #37".
  • Email garage sale — Coach Z counts himself as a mom.
  • Email senior prom — Homestar mistakes Coach Z for Strong Sad's date, "Deborah".
  • Email rated — Strong Bad thinks Coach Z kinda looks like his mom, and Coach Z responds by asking if he should shave his legs.
  • Date Nite — The last scene implies that Coach Z belives that Bubs is his date (hence the the fact that he acts like a housewife and wears hair curlers), while Bubs was really Marzipan's next date.

Senor Cardgage

  • Email kind of coolStrong Bad boasts that Creepy Comb-over Strong Bad would still be "so cool, that even if you were a dude, [he'd] still call at you like you were a lady." In an Easter Egg, Senor Cardgage calls Strong Bad "ma'am," and later, "Ethel".
  • Email flashback Senor Cardgage refers to Strong Bad as "Elizagerth"
  • Senor Mortgage — Senor Cardgage calls the Visor Robot "Valerie".
  • Senorial Day — Senor Cardgage calls Strong Bad "Ms. America".
  • Email rough copy Senor Cardgage refers to Strong Bad as "Grendolyn".
  • Email rated — Senor Cardgage calls Strong Bad "Bridget".
